Introduction: Hello! My name is Rosana Gomez Valdor. I am an organized, hard worker and dedicated person who loves playing golf. I am originally from Spain but moved to the United States seven years ago driven by my passion for golf. I have been playing golf since I was 11 years old. Throughout my golf career, I have won several individual tournaments at the state as well as national level. I also competed with the state team. While obtaining my bachelors, I was able to play for the University of Texas at El Paso on a golf scholarship. During that time, we made history by winning the conference tournament for the first time in school history. Individually, my average moved from 81 during my freshman year to 75 in my senior year. I got several top ten finishes during all four years I played for the team. After earning my bachelor's degree, I was offered another scholarship as the graduate assistant coach position by Jerry Pelletier, head coach of the woman's golf team. During that time, I was assigned different tasks including organizing off the course workouts, long and short game practices as well as course management. I also helped with the recruiting process and equipment management. While earning both of my degrees, I gave private golf lessons to adults and taught free golf lessons to children for a community service program called First Tee. It is always a pleasure to teach and help others to improve their game so that they can keep enjoying this amazing and challenging sport. Currently, I continue playing golf, and I am going to participate in the q-school for the LPGA Tour next summer. I am also working at Green River Golf Club as Marshall, Starter and as one of the instructors for a player development program for adults and children.
